This toolkit provides practical tips and step-by-step information to help NHS employers to implement the six parts of the National Institute for Health and Clinical Excellence (NICE) workplace guidance.

Filled with case studies, infographics, checklists, tips, research and useful links, it includes sections on long-term sickness absence, mental wellbeing, obesity, smoking and physical activity. It also provides information on:

  • what the NICE guidance says
  • why it’s important to take action
  • what national research tells us
  • suggested recommendations and approaches
  • top tips from the NHS Employers health and wellbeing network.
